Bhubaneswar: Sangram Keshari Mohanty, son of Jana Adhikar Manch convener was remanded in Berhampur jail for three days on Wednesday.

Sangram was produced before JMFC in Sorada for trial in five different cases after he was brought from Paralakhemundi jail where he was lodged after being arrested on December 5. His link in several Maoist related activities was alleged.

According to sources, Sangram was accused of planting landmines at Talapatma village under Badagada police limits which the police recovered In September 2011. Also, he was allegedly involved in the blast of cellphone towers at Goudagotha and Baroda under same police limits.

In December last, Mohona police in Gajapati district had arrested Sangram on charges of Maoist activities and seized arms, ammunition and Maoist literature from him.
